Early days.

Following on from the comments regarding training for techies, as one of the ground crew who saw in the first frame to Thorney Island in '67 the first A/F was completed with the flight servicing schedule in the left hand and a glossary in the right as we tried to decipher the American English and technical terms. All we knew was that the Lockheed rep said the Flt servicing started at the crew door and went clockwise round the aircraft! In the usual time honoured way I had worked on the Herc for nearly a year before getting on the ground school.
And doing the first prop change purely by the book produced some memorable moments, some of which we had rather that we didn't remember. Having come onto the Herc from the mighty Beverly it was just a little bit of a culture shock!
